Senator Trump moved to amend the bill by striking out the title and substituting therefor a new title, to read as follows:

Eng. Com. Sub. for Senate Bill 290--A Bill to amend and reenact §21-5-3 of the Code of West Virginia, 1931, as amended, relating to assignment of wages by employers and payment of wages by payroll card; authorizing assignment without notarization or required statement that assignment cannot be for more than twenty-five percent of employee’s wages; requiring that assignment be appropriately witnessed by an individual who shall sign and provide his or her name in print; allowing wage assignments to be valid for longer than one year; and removing requirement for written agreement to pay employee by payroll card.
